如何提升AI聊天软件的对话准确率?

在一个繁华的都市中,有一位年轻的程序员李明,他热衷于人工智能的研究,尤其是AI聊天软件的开发。李明深知,随着人工智能技术的不断发展,AI聊天软件已经成为人们生活中不可或缺的一部分。然而,他也意识到,当前许多AI聊天软件在对话准确率上还存在不少问题,这给用户体验带来了不小的困扰。为了提升AI聊天软件的对话准确率,李明开始了他的研究之旅。

李明首先分析了当前AI聊天软件存在的问题。他发现,大多数聊天软件在对话准确率上存在以下三个问题:

  1. 语义理解能力不足:AI聊天软件往往无法准确理解用户的意图,导致回复内容与用户需求不符。

  2. 上下文关联性差:AI聊天软件在处理连续对话时,难以捕捉到对话的上下文信息,使得回复内容显得断章取义。

  3. 知识库更新滞后:AI聊天软件的知识库更新速度较慢,无法及时满足用户对最新信息的需求。

为了解决这些问题,李明从以下几个方面入手,提升AI聊天软件的对话准确率:

一、优化语义理解能力

  1. 增强语料库:李明收集了大量的人类对话语料,用于训练AI聊天软件的语义理解模型。通过不断扩充语料库,使AI聊天软件能够更好地理解用户的意图。

  2. 语义分析技术:李明采用了先进的语义分析技术,如依存句法分析、指代消解等,提高AI聊天软件对语义的理解能力。

  3. 情感分析:李明在AI聊天软件中加入了情感分析功能,使软件能够识别用户的情绪,并根据情绪调整回复内容,提高对话的准确率。

二、提升上下文关联性

  1. 上下文追踪:李明设计了上下文追踪机制,使AI聊天软件能够捕捉到对话中的关键信息,并据此生成合适的回复。

  2. 语境理解:李明通过研究人类对话的语境,使AI聊天软件能够更好地理解对话中的隐含意义,提高对话的准确率。

  3. 对话生成模型:李明采用了生成式对话模型,使AI聊天软件能够根据上下文信息生成连贯、自然的对话内容。

三、加快知识库更新速度

  1. 智能更新:李明设计了智能更新机制,使AI聊天软件能够自动从互联网上获取最新信息,并更新知识库。

  2. 人工审核:为了确保知识库的准确性,李明安排了专业团队对知识库进行人工审核,确保信息的真实性。

  3. 用户反馈:李明鼓励用户对AI聊天软件的回复进行反馈,根据用户反馈不断优化知识库。

经过一段时间的努力,李明的AI聊天软件在对话准确率上取得了显著的提升。他的软件不仅能够准确理解用户的意图,还能根据上下文信息生成连贯、自然的对话内容。此外,软件的知识库也始终保持更新,满足了用户对最新信息的需求。

然而,李明并没有满足于此。他深知,人工智能技术日新月异,AI聊天软件的对话准确率仍有很大的提升空间。为了进一步提高对话准确率,李明开始着手研究以下几个方面:

  1. 多模态交互:李明计划将图像、语音等多模态信息融入AI聊天软件,使软件能够更全面地理解用户的需求。

  2. 跨领域知识融合:李明希望通过融合不同领域的知识,使AI聊天软件具备更广泛的知识储备,提高对话的准确率。

  3. 深度学习技术:李明将继续深入研究深度学习技术,以提高AI聊天软件的语义理解能力和上下文关联性。

在李明的努力下,AI聊天软件的对话准确率不断提升,为用户带来了更好的体验。而李明本人也成为了人工智能领域的佼佼者。他坚信,随着人工智能技术的不断发展,AI聊天软件将会在未来发挥更大的作用,为人们的生活带来更多便利。

猜你喜欢:AI问答助手